### Action Item: Spoolhaven Retry Storm

From last Tuesday's outage: the Spoolhaven print service retried failed jobs without backoff, saturating the render pool. Fix merged; retries now use capped exponential backoff with jitter. Owner will monitor for a week before closing. The agreed retry constants are recorded below.

constants for yadup-kajof:
RATE_LIMITS = {
    "zorwyn": 1,
    "druwyn": 1,
}

// Alert deduplicator for the Pellwick on-call pipeline.
// Collapses alerts sharing a fingerprint within the window; suppressed
// duplicates still increment the counter shown on the page. If you're
// paged twice for one incident, the window is too short — widen it and
// note it in the handoff doc. Flushes on shutdown, so restarts don't
// drop alerts. Tunables follow.

tuning table, yajog-yahof:
BUDGETS = {
    "lamvan": 303,
    "wenox": 460,
    "fenvan": 525,
}

Template rendering now defaults to precompiled partials instead of per-request parsing. Benchmarks on the Quillmark staging cluster showed a 38% reduction in median render time for pages with more than five nested partials. The old behavior caused repeated lexing of identical templates under load, which dominated CPU during the Harwick traffic spikes. Cache eviction now uses LRU with a fixed slot count rather than TTL expiry. Reviewers should verify the fallback path for dynamic templates. The new defaults shipped to staging are as follows.

deployment values, kajep-kageg:
[praix]
host = praix.paliqcorp.corp
user = praix_svc
database = praix_prod

## Publishing Validator Plugins

Validator plugins for the Quillgate platform must be packaged as a single archive containing your manifest and compiled checks. Run `qg-plugin build` and confirm the output passes the local conformance suite before submission. The registry rejects unsigned archives, so every upload must carry a detached signature generated with the key issued to your author account. Rotation happens quarterly; stale keys are revoked automatically. Sign your archive with the key shown below.

rollout seal: bky4_x7Gc